About this map

The Trent River meanders through Jones County, North Carolina, defining a landscape of low-lying wetlands and scattered rural settlements during the late 1970s and early 1980s. The southern portion of the quadrangle is dominated by the dense timberlands of the Hofmann Forest and the saturated terrain of the White Oak Pocosin, where the indefinite boundary reflects the challenging hydrology of the coastal plain.
